CIBER Global ForumsPenn Lauder CIBER co-sponsors the annual Wharton Global Business Forum, a two-day conference organized by Wharton graduate students. It is the pre-eminent business school event addressing the major economic, social, and political trends affecting the major regions of the world. This conference combines five separate international student-run conferences addressing the globalization of various regions' economies while remaining focused on domestic trends and concerns. In November 2006, top-caliber speakers, panelists, and guests from around the world convened in Philadelphia to focus on issues particular to Africa, Asia, and India.
